Your hideout is behind the northwest door in the outer wall of the apartment complex ring. You can transit back here from other parts of Taris to heal your party (where this is possible).

When you first exit your apartment, you encounter a Sith patrol. Afterward, you only need to get to the Upper City elevator on the south side: if you travel clockwise to your left then you can question the janitor for information and directions, and if you travel counter-clockwise to your right then you can encounter Larrim, a merchant who can sell and buy items. You can also break into four other apartments and search any containers for items.

Breaking into Dia's apartment to the west and speaking to her can also trigger an optional quest which can move you closer to the dark side of the Force, or later the light side (particularly if you tell her to keep her reward). All other residents are restricted to comments rather than dialog.

When paused during combat, you have your first chance to select Carth: based on his current equipment, Dexterity and feats he has already progressed towards using two blaster pistols. However, if you're a Scoundrel or otherwise have low Vitality, then when confronted with multiple opponents equipping melee weapons you may want to equip him with one or two melee weapons, at least temporarily, and have him lead, if only until you have another party member to take the front line.

You and Carth can kill one battle droid each in a single round, particularly if equipping the Ion Blaster from the Sith heavy trooper on the Starboard Section of the Endar Spire and Carth uses Power Blast. Then only the Sith soldier remains:

All three can be killed with a Frag Grenade, although this will also damage the Duros. The two battle droids will be killed even with a successful Reflex save, while there's 60% chance of killing the Sith soldier (otherwise, he'll be reduced from 15 to 5 Vitality).

There are four other apartments accessed via low security doors in the outer wall of the apartment complex ring.

Security Low Security Door (4) Unlock 12 (0) Bash Resist 5 Vitality 20

Any character who spent even a single point in Security (including Carth) can unlock them. They can also be bashed open, although this may be more time consuming this early in the game.

The northeast apartment is unoccupied but contains a footlocker, the southeast one contains an Ithorian and a bag, while that to the southwest contains a Twi'lek and a bag:

The contents of all these containers are random, although they were generated with the map. Surprisingly robbery doesn't result in any shift in alignment, although you may want to forbear if you're role-playing a light side character.

Dia's apartment is behind the door to the west, and unlocking rather than bashing the door allows you to enter and look around first, finding another bag. Otherwise, Dia confronts you immediately.

Larrim's items cost 10% extra to buy, so think twice before doing so. Items that cannot be bought anywhere else on Taris are highlighted in bold, although the Energy Shields about which Larrim spoke can be received from various remains and other containers later on, so there’s no need to buy one here.

The apartment complex is a ring, with the doors to four apartments (excluding your hideout) and the elevator to the Upper City in the outer wall. The latter is to the south, and the quickest way to reach it from your apartment is to run counter-clockwise around the ring, hugging the inner wall to avoid Larrim speaking as you pass.
